Cemeteries & Years in Use

Essex Center: 1795-present
Fairview: 1927-present
Holy Family: 1893-present
Mountain View: 1875-present
Village: 1795-present


Local Historical Societies, Libraries & Museums

Essex Community Historical Society
Routes 15 & 128
Essex Center, VT
Mailing Address:
3 Browns River Road
Essex Junction, VT 05452
802-878-1354
http://www.essex.org/esxhs/esxhsfindex.htm
A collection of costumes, school items, and local memorabilia in a former two-room schoolhouse. Contact Persons: Ron Clapp, President; Lucille Allen, Secretary; Eva Clough, Treasurer. Hours and Admission: Early June to mid-October, Sat. and Sun., 1 – 4pm. Free. Accessible to the disabled.
